Slab Contrasted Komod 2 is a regular weight, normal width,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

This typeface is a sturdy slab serif with bold, squared serifs and clearly bracketed joins, giving the letterforms a grounded, weighty stance. Strokes show noticeable contrast, with thicker verticals and comparatively lighter connecting strokes, while terminals remain crisp and blunt rather than tapered. Proportions are relatively compact with a moderate x-height; counters are open and well-shaped, supporting legibility in continuous text. The rhythm is steady and even, with strong horizontals and a consistent, print-like texture across uppercase, lowercase, and figures.

It performs well in editorial settings such as magazines, newspapers, and book interiors where a firm serif voice is desired without sacrificing readability. The strong slab serifs and pronounced structure also suit headlines, pull quotes, signage-style titling, and brand systems that need a classic, trustworthy tone.

The overall tone is authoritative and traditional, with a distinctly editorial presence that feels dependable and established. Its strong slabs and confident structure evoke classic publishing, institutional communication, and workmanlike practicality rather than delicacy or exuberance.

The design appears intended to combine traditional slab-serif sturdiness with enough contrast and refinement to work in both text and display contexts. It aims to deliver a confident, authoritative texture on the page, balancing robust serifs with familiar, readable lowercase forms.

Uppercase forms read as formal and architectural, while the lowercase maintains familiar, text-oriented shapes that keep paragraphs calm and readable. Numerals are solid and high-impact, matching the weight and squareness of the serif treatment and contributing to a cohesive, headline-friendly color.
